    Default Re: The Knee Jerk (and just PO'd) Thread (MET)

    I agree. It's okay to implement some aspects of the college spread. But what the Panthers, Broncos and now the Redskins have been forced to learn is that it is an alternate look out of a base set, not a base set. I think Kyle is overcompensating for the eroding talent base of the team too, we're down to our 3rd and 4th string at SEVERAL positions (Paulsen is at best a #2, Robinson and Hankerson are not ready to be matched up against the best opposing DBs yet, and our current safeties were supposed to be reserves from the start), and we're not the Packers who have had 5 or so years of good drafting to pick up the slack when that happens.

    The problem is that Shanahan has made several major mistakes that are biting us in the ass - keeping Has because they were study buddies in his off year, keeping Danny Smith, trading for McNabb and Brown which forced us to pass up J.J Watt among other things (and we're now seeing that Kerrigan is a 2nd tier OLB, not a first tier OLB - he just doesn't have the physical profile to be elite), and I guess you can add stuff like signing Josh Morgan instead of Eric Winston.
